Recent Episodes

September 14, 2020
2) Wildlife Conservation - George the Explorer
The award winning wildlife photographer, George "the Explorer" Benjamin, goes in depth about his journey becoming a wildlife photographer , what it takes to create change in the wildlife conservation field, and some pretty incredible moments along the way!

August 17, 2020
1) Create More Than You Consume - Carmen Huter
Award winning travel photographer, Carmen Huter, shares some of her personal travel experiences, her journey to becoming a content creator, and what lead her down the path to living a more sustainable lifestyle.
